Package org.jboss.as.txn.subsystem
Class TransactionSubsystemRootResourceDefinition
java.lang.Object
org.jboss.as.controller.ResourceDefinition.MinimalResourceDefinition
org.jboss.as.controller.SimpleResourceDefinition
org.jboss.as.txn.subsystem.TransactionSubsystemRootResourceDefinition
- All Implemented Interfaces:
org.jboss.as.controller.Feature,org.jboss.as.controller.ResourceDefinition,org.jboss.as.controller.ResourceRegistration
public class TransactionSubsystemRootResourceDefinition
extends org.jboss.as.controller.SimpleResourceDefinition
ResourceDefinition for the root resource of the transaction subsystem.- Author:
- Brian Stansberry (c) 2011 Red Hat Inc.
-
Nested Class Summary
Nested classes/interfaces inherited from class org.jboss.as.controller.SimpleResourceDefinition
org.jboss.as.controller.SimpleResourceDefinition.ParametersNested classes/interfaces inherited from interface org.jboss.as.controller.ResourceDefinition
org.jboss.as.controller.ResourceDefinition.AbstractConfigurator<C extends org.jboss.as.controller.ResourceDefinition.Configurator<C>>, org.jboss.as.controller.ResourceDefinition.Builder, org.jboss.as.controller.ResourceDefinition.Configurator<C extends org.jboss.as.controller.ResourceDefinition.Configurator<C>>, org.jboss.as.controller.ResourceDefinition.MinimalBuilder, org.jboss.as.controller.ResourceDefinition.MinimalResourceDefinition -
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.capability.RuntimeCapability<Void>Capability that indicates a local TransactionManager provider is present.static final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.capability.RuntimeCapability<Void>static final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.capability.RuntimeCapability<Void>Provides access to the special TransactionSynchronizationRegistry impl that ensures proper ordering between Jakarta Connectors and other synchronizations.static final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.SimpleAttributeDefinitionstatic final org.jboss.as.controller.SimpleAttributeDefinition -
Method Summary
Modifier and TypeMethodDescriptionprotected voidregisterAddOperation(org.jboss.as.controller.registry.ManagementResourceRegistration registration, org.jboss.as.controller.OperationStepHandler handler, org.jboss.as.controller.registry.OperationEntry.Flag... flags) voidregisterAttributes(org.jboss.as.controller.registry.ManagementResourceRegistration resourceRegistration) voidregisterChildren(org.jboss.as.controller.registry.ManagementResourceRegistration resourceRegistration) Methods inherited from class org.jboss.as.controller.SimpleResourceDefinition
getAddOperationParameters, getDeprecationData, getFlagsSet, getResourceDescriptionResolver, registerAdditionalRuntimePackages, registerAddOperation, registerCapabilities, registerNotifications, registerOperations, registerRemoveOperation, registerRemoveOperation, setDeprecatedMethods inherited from class org.jboss.as.controller.ResourceDefinition.MinimalResourceDefinition
getAccessConstraints, getDescriptionProvider, getMaxOccurs, getMinOccurs, getPathElement, getStability, isFeature, isOrderedChild, isRuntime
-
Field Details
-
LOCAL_PROVIDER_CAPABILITY
public static final org.jboss.as.controller.capability.RuntimeCapability<Void> LOCAL_PROVIDER_CAPABILITYCapability that indicates a local TransactionManager provider is present. -
TRANSACTION_SYNCHRONIZATION_REGISTRY_CAPABILITY
public static final org.jboss.as.controller.capability.RuntimeCapability<Void> TRANSACTION_SYNCHRONIZATION_REGISTRY_CAPABILITYProvides access to the special TransactionSynchronizationRegistry impl that ensures proper ordering between Jakarta Connectors and other synchronizations. -
REMOTE_TRANSACTION_SERVICE_CAPABILITY
public static final org.jboss.as.controller.capability.RuntimeCapability<Void> REMOTE_TRANSACTION_SERVICE_CAPABILITY -
BINDING
public static final org.jboss.as.controller.SimpleAttributeDefinition BINDING -
STATUS_BINDING
public static final org.jboss.as.controller.SimpleAttributeDefinition STATUS_BINDING -
RECOVERY_LISTENER
public static final org.jboss.as.controller.SimpleAttributeDefinition RECOVERY_LISTENER -
NODE_IDENTIFIER
public static final org.jboss.as.controller.SimpleAttributeDefinition NODE_IDENTIFIER -
PROCESS_ID_UUID
public static final org.jboss.as.controller.SimpleAttributeDefinition PROCESS_ID_UUID -
PROCESS_ID_SOCKET_BINDING
public static final org.jboss.as.controller.SimpleAttributeDefinition PROCESS_ID_SOCKET_BINDING -
PROCESS_ID_SOCKET_MAX_PORTS
public static final org.jboss.as.controller.SimpleAttributeDefinition PROCESS_ID_SOCKET_MAX_PORTS -
STATISTICS_ENABLED
public static final org.jboss.as.controller.SimpleAttributeDefinition STATISTICS_ENABLED -
ENABLE_STATISTICS
public static final org.jboss.as.controller.SimpleAttributeDefinition ENABLE_STATISTICS -
ENABLE_TSM_STATUS
public static final org.jboss.as.controller.SimpleAttributeDefinition ENABLE_TSM_STATUS -
DEFAULT_TIMEOUT
public static final org.jboss.as.controller.SimpleAttributeDefinition DEFAULT_TIMEOUT -
MAXIMUM_TIMEOUT
public static final org.jboss.as.controller.SimpleAttributeDefinition MAXIMUM_TIMEOUT -
OBJECT_STORE_RELATIVE_TO
public static final org.jboss.as.controller.SimpleAttributeDefinition OBJECT_STORE_RELATIVE_TO -
OBJECT_STORE_PATH
public static final org.jboss.as.controller.SimpleAttributeDefinition OBJECT_STORE_PATH -
JTS
public static final org.jboss.as.controller.SimpleAttributeDefinition JTS -
USE_HORNETQ_STORE
public static final org.jboss.as.controller.SimpleAttributeDefinition USE_HORNETQ_STORE -
HORNETQ_STORE_ENABLE_ASYNC_IO
public static final org.jboss.as.controller.SimpleAttributeDefinition HORNETQ_STORE_ENABLE_ASYNC_IO -
USE_JOURNAL_STORE
public static final org.jboss.as.controller.SimpleAttributeDefinition USE_JOURNAL_STORE -
JOURNAL_STORE_ENABLE_ASYNC_IO
public static final org.jboss.as.controller.SimpleAttributeDefinition JOURNAL_STORE_ENABLE_ASYNC_IO -
USE_JDBC_STORE
public static final org.jboss.as.controller.SimpleAttributeDefinition USE_JDBC_STORE -
JDBC_STORE_DATASOURCE
public static final org.jboss.as.controller.SimpleAttributeDefinition JDBC_STORE_DATASOURCE -
JDBC_ACTION_STORE_TABLE_PREFIX
public static final org.jboss.as.controller.SimpleAttributeDefinition JDBC_ACTION_STORE_TABLE_PREFIX -
JDBC_ACTION_STORE_DROP_TABLE
public static final org.jboss.as.controller.SimpleAttributeDefinition JDBC_ACTION_STORE_DROP_TABLE -
JDBC_COMMUNICATION_STORE_TABLE_PREFIX
public static final org.jboss.as.controller.SimpleAttributeDefinition JDBC_COMMUNICATION_STORE_TABLE_PREFIX -
JDBC_COMMUNICATION_STORE_DROP_TABLE
public static final org.jboss.as.controller.SimpleAttributeDefinition JDBC_COMMUNICATION_STORE_DROP_TABLE -
JDBC_STATE_STORE_TABLE_PREFIX
public static final org.jboss.as.controller.SimpleAttributeDefinition JDBC_STATE_STORE_TABLE_PREFIX -
JDBC_STATE_STORE_DROP_TABLE
public static final org.jboss.as.controller.SimpleAttributeDefinition JDBC_STATE_STORE_DROP_TABLE -
STALE_TRANSACTION_TIME
public static final org.jboss.as.controller.SimpleAttributeDefinition STALE_TRANSACTION_TIME
-
-
Method Details
-
registerAttributes
public void registerAttributes(org.jboss.as.controller.registry.ManagementResourceRegistration resourceRegistration) - Specified by:
registerAttributesin interfaceorg.jboss.as.controller.ResourceDefinition- Overrides:
registerAttributesin classorg.jboss.as.controller.SimpleResourceDefinition
-
registerAddOperation
protected void registerAddOperation(org.jboss.as.controller.registry.ManagementResourceRegistration registration, org.jboss.as.controller.OperationStepHandler handler, org.jboss.as.controller.registry.OperationEntry.Flag... flags) - Overrides:
registerAddOperationin classorg.jboss.as.controller.SimpleResourceDefinition
-
registerChildren
public void registerChildren(org.jboss.as.controller.registry.ManagementResourceRegistration resourceRegistration) - Specified by:
registerChildrenin interfaceorg.jboss.as.controller.ResourceDefinition- Overrides:
registerChildrenin classorg.jboss.as.controller.SimpleResourceDefinition
-